数据库包括表和什么
-
数据库包括表和数据库管理系统(DBMS)。
-
表:数据库中最基本的组成单元是表。表由行和列组成,类似于电子表格。每一行代表一个记录,每一列代表一个字段。表用于存储和组织数据,并提供了对数据的增删改查操作。
-
数据库管理系统(DBMS):数据库管理系统是用于管理和操作数据库的软件。它负责处理数据库的创建、维护、备份和恢复等任务。DBMS还提供了对数据库的访问控制、事务处理、并发控制和数据完整性等功能。
-
索引:索引是数据库中用于加快数据检索速度的数据结构。它类似于书籍的目录,通过建立索引可以快速定位到需要的数据。索引可以建立在表的某个或多个列上,提高查询性能。
-
视图:视图是基于一个或多个表的查询结果,它是一个虚拟表。视图可以简化复杂的查询操作,隐藏底层表的细节,并提供了一种安全的数据访问方式。
-
存储过程和触发器:存储过程是一组预编译的SQL语句,可以在DBMS中执行。它们可以接受参数,执行一系列操作,并返回结果。触发器是一种特殊的存储过程,它在数据库中的特定事件发生时自动执行。
总之,数据库包括表和数据库管理系统(DBMS),以及其他的辅助工具和功能,如索引、视图、存储过程和触发器等。这些组成部分共同构成了一个完整的数据库系统,用于存储和管理大量的数据。
1年前 -
-
数据库包括表和索引。
表是数据库中数据的组织形式,它由行和列组成。每个表代表一个实体或概念,例如一个员工表、一个订单表或一个产品表。表中的行表示表中的一个记录或数据项,而列表示记录中的一个属性或字段。通过表,可以方便地存储和管理大量的数据。
索引是用于加快数据检索速度的数据结构。它类似于书籍的目录,通过索引可以快速定位到指定的数据行。索引可以基于一个或多个列进行创建,并且可以选择性地指定排序方式。通过使用索引,可以大大提高数据库的查询效率。
数据库表和索引是数据库中两个重要的组成部分。表用于存储和组织数据,而索引用于提高数据检索的速度。数据库的设计和优化需要考虑表的结构和索引的选择,以便达到更高的性能和更好的用户体验。
1年前 -
数据库包括表和视图。
表是数据库中最基本的组成单位,它用来存储和组织数据。表由行和列组成,行代表数据的记录,列代表数据的属性。每一行都包含了一条记录的数据,每一列都包含了同一类型的数据。表的结构由表名、列名和数据类型等定义。
视图是一个虚拟表,它是基于一个或多个表的查询结果。视图可以被用来简化复杂的查询操作,隐藏数据的细节以及提供安全性。视图在逻辑上是表的一种表现形式,但实际上并不存储数据,而是通过查询表的结果动态生成。
在数据库中,表和视图是用来存储和管理数据的重要工具。它们可以用来存储各种类型的数据,如用户信息、订单信息、产品信息等。通过表和视图,可以实现数据的增加、删除、修改和查询等操作。下面将介绍表和视图的创建、修改、查询和删除等操作流程。
一、表的操作流程
- 创建表
创建表需要定义表的名称、列名和数据类型。可以使用SQL语句来创建表,例如:
CREATE TABLE 表名 ( 列名1 数据类型1, 列名2 数据类型2, ... );其中,表名是要创建的表的名称,列名是表中列的名称,数据类型是列中存储的数据类型。可以根据需要定义多个列。
- 修改表
在已创建的表上进行修改操作,可以包括添加列、修改列和删除列等操作。使用ALTER TABLE语句来修改表的结构,例如:
ALTER TABLE 表名 ADD 列名 数据类型;这个语句用于在表中添加新的列。
- 插入数据
插入数据是将具体的记录添加到表中。使用INSERT INTO语句来插入数据,例如:
INSERT INTO 表名 (列名1, 列名2, ...) VALUES (值1, 值2, ...);其中,表名是要插入数据的表的名称,列名是要插入数据的列的名称,值是要插入的具体数据。
- 更新数据
更新数据是修改表中已有记录的操作。使用UPDATE语句来更新数据,例如:
UPDATE 表名 SET 列名1 = 新值1, 列名2 = 新值2, ... WHERE 条件;其中,表名是要更新数据的表的名称,列名是要更新数据的列的名称,新值是要更新为的新值,条件是筛选要更新的记录的条件。
- 删除数据
删除数据是从表中删除记录的操作。使用DELETE FROM语句来删除数据,例如:
DELETE FROM 表名 WHERE 条件;其中,表名是要删除数据的表的名称,条件是筛选要删除的记录的条件。
- 查询数据
查询数据是从表中检索记录的操作。使用SELECT语句来查询数据,例如:
SELECT 列名1, 列名2, ... FROM 表名 WHERE 条件;其中,列名是要查询的列的名称,表名是要查询的表的名称,条件是筛选要查询的记录的条件。
二、视图的操作流程
- 创建视图
创建视图需要定义视图的名称、列名和查询语句。使用CREATE VIEW语句来创建视图,例如:
CREATE VIEW 视图名 AS SELECT 列名1, 列名2, ... FROM 表名 WHERE 条件;其中,视图名是要创建的视图的名称,列名是要查询的列的名称,表名是要查询的表的名称,条件是筛选要查询的记录的条件。
- 修改视图
修改视图可以包括修改视图的查询语句和修改视图的列名。使用ALTER VIEW语句来修改视图,例如:
ALTER VIEW 视图名 AS SELECT 列名1 AS 新列名1, 列名2 AS 新列名2, ... FROM 表名 WHERE 条件;其中,视图名是要修改的视图的名称,列名是要查询的列的名称,新列名是要修改为的新列名,表名是要查询的表的名称,条件是筛选要查询的记录的条件。
- 删除视图
删除视图是将视图从数据库中移除的操作。使用DROP VIEW语句来删除视图,例如:
DROP VIEW 视图名;其中,视图名是要删除的视图的名称。
通过以上的操作流程,可以对数据库中的表和视图进行创建、修改、查询和删除等操作。这些操作可以帮助我们更好地管理和利用数据库中的数据。
1年前 - 创建表